Two‐Dimensional Echocardiography in Myocardial Amyloidosis

Echocardiography, 1991
Two‐dimensional echocardiography is the best means of identifying early cardiac amyloid infiltration and gauging its subsequent progression. The early asymptomatic phase is characterized on echocardiography by a mild‐to‐moderate increase in left ventricular and/or right ventricular wall thicknesses.

Digital two-dimensional echocardiography

1985
Over the past two decades, echocardiography has emerged as an essential diagnostic tool in clinical cardiology. This is related to the fact that it is entirely noninvasive, can be readily performed at the bedside, and can provide accurate and reproducible information at no known risk to the patient.
